November  Panchang/Muhurats for the month of November,2020                                (Month of Festivals)
Panchang is an ancient Indian calendar system based on astronomical data. Calendar calculations are done based on the position and movement of the planets, stars, nakshatra and constellations. Panchang is very useful in determining the ideal or auspicious vaar, tithis, yogas, nakshatras and karan commonly called the muhurat, for carrying out various activities like vivah muhurat or marriage,greh pravesh, starting a festival puja etc.
Tumblr media
  I am sharing with you the Panchang Hindu Calendar for the November 2020. Hope you will find it useful for planning of your various activities. 
Festivals during the month of November,2020-
Karwa Chauth             : - 4th November
Ahoi Ashtami               : - 8th November
Dhanteras                      - 13th November
Hanuman Jyanti            : 13th November
Narak Chaturdashi        :- 14th November
Maha Lakshmi Pujan      :-14th November
Annkoot Goverdhan Puj:- 15th November
Bhai dooj                      : - 16th November
Vishwakarma day            : -16th November
Surya Shashtu                 : -20th November
Tulsi Vivah                        :- 26th November
Kartika Purnima               :- 30th November
Guru nanak Jyanti            :- 30th November
Ekadashi November 2020:- Rama Ekadashi on 11th November,2020 and Dev parbodhni   Ekadashi on 25th November ,2020
Margashirsha Sakranti :- 16th November 2020 Sun will enter in Scorpio at 6.53 AM
Amavasya :- 15th November ,2020 Kartik Amavasya
Ganesh Chaurthi:- 4th November, 2020 ( Krishan Paksha)- kartik  month and 18th November ,2020 (Shukal Paksha) Aswin month
Triyodshi/Pardosh fast on :-27th November ,2020  Shukal Paksha ( Kartik month) and 13th November ,2020 Krishan Paksha- Kartik month  
Pradosh Vrat is auspicious devoted to Lord Shiva.
Purnima:- 30th November Kartik month
Shubh Muhurats in November 2020 :-       
  Engagement in the month of November 2020:- 2nd ,10th,12th 19th,21st,24th,25th,27th and 30th November ,2020
Marriage dates in month of November 2020:- 2nd,9th,10th,11th,12th,18th,20th,21st,22nd,24th and 25th November,2020
Vehicles Purchase dates in November 2020: -6th ,12th,19th,20th,25th and 27th November,2020
These dates are most auspicious
The best Nakshatra for purchase of Vehicles are Shatbisha, Rohini, Mrigashira, Punarvasu, Pushya, Chitra, Swati and Sharvana
* Avoid Saturday if Saturn is bad in the chart and avoid Moon falls on 4th, 6th and 8th in transit from Natal Moon
Greh Parvesh:- Vishakha, Bharni, Alshesha and Magha Nakshatra are inauspicious for Greh parvesh.
Tithi:- 4th,9th,15t and 30th are inauspicious as per Hindi dates for Greh Parvesh
Sunday and Tuesday dates are inauspicious for Greh parvesh.
The best Months for Greh Parvesh are Vaishak,Sharavana,Phalguni and Aswin.
The house to be shifted in Fixed Lagna  Taurus, Leo and Scorpio.
The house to be shifted in Shukal Paksha on Monday,Wednesday,Thursday, Friday or Saturday.
There are dates in Krishan Paksha are auspicious but Shukal Paksha are most auspicious.
Old house:-No Mahurut
New House:- 6th,7th,12th,21st25th,27th and 30th November,2020
Inauspicious Nakshatra in November, 2020:-Gand Moola Nakshatra:- Ashwini, Ashlesha, Magha, Jyestha , Moola and Revati
Gand Mool  Nakshatra:-
Aslesha Nakshatra 8th November,2020 from  08.45  AM till 10th November,2020 Magha Nakshatra  up
to 07.56 AM
Jyestha Nakshatra  16th November 2020 from  14.37 PM till  18th November ,2020 Moola Nakshatra till 10.40  AM
Revati Nakshatra from 25th November ,2020 till 12.00 PM till 27th November ,2020 till Ashwini  Nakshatra 07.36 AM.
Tumblr media
  Panchak ;- 21st November ,2020 from 22.26 PM till 26th November ,2020 till 21.20  PM
Stars position in November,2020
Sun will enter in Scorpio 17th November, 2020 at 06.54 AM
Mars running in Pisces retrograde from 05/10/2020 and will move forward from 14/11/2020
Mercury will be running in Scorpio from  28/11/2020 at 07.04 AM
Mercury to retrograde from 14/10/2020 and will move forward from 03/11/2020
Jupiter in Sagittarius till 20th November,2020
Jupiter will enter in Capricorn on 20/11/2020 at 13.23 PM
Venus to enter in Libra  on 17/11/2020 at 10.45 AM
Saturn running in Capricorn from 24/01/2020 from 9.56 AM
Rahu running in Taurus from 23rd September,2020
Mercury will move forward on 03/11/2020
Mercury will rise on 31/10/2020

Karwa chauth 2020: If you have these ailments, don't fast
Tumblr media
New delhi date. 04 November 2020, Wednesday
The fast of Karva Choth is kept for the longevity of the husband. This vow is kept by married women or virgin women for husband or fianc. The rules of fasting are very difficult and women have to fast all day long, hungry and thirsty. Considering the pre-health condition, health experts advise some women not to observe this fast.
According to the Allopathy Physician, if a woman has a complaint of diabetes, she should not keep this fast. Living without food and water all day can lead to hypoglycemia.
If a woman has a problem with high blood pressure or low blood pressure, she is also advised not to fast. Patients with BP should avoid fasting, as prolonged starvation can cause BP to fluctuate. Control of BP depends entirely on medications and diet.
No seriously ill woman should observe this fast. If a woman is undergoing treatment or taking any kind of medicine, she should not fast either. Doing so can cause further damage to health.
It is not advisable for both the developing baby and the mother to go hungry for hours. That is why even pregnant women are advised not to observe the fourth fast. Women who are breastfeeding their newborns should also avoid fasting. These women need a certain amount of calories or nutrients over a short period of time.
Women should consult a doctor once before fasting if they show signs of bad health condition or any disease. Even if you know about pre-health condition, your doctor will never advise you to take any risk. If the doctor allows you to fast, he will also advise you to take some precautions that you must follow.

Karwa Chauth 2020: Significance of Vrat and The Myth of The Hindu Festival
Tumblr media
According to Hindu Mythology, Karva Chauth pooja is observed across the nation in the month of Karthik (Hindu calendar). On the fourth day of the Karthik month, Hindu married women pray for their husband’s long life and seek blessings from God. The married women observe fast on this auspicious day by offering Karva Chauth pooja. Adding that, they also offer food to God, which is considered as a part of Karva Chauth pooja. It is believed that Karva Chauth Vrat strengthens the husband-wife relationship and blesses them with a long and healthy life.
Over the years, however, the festival of Karwa Chauth has become more than just fasting, here are Five Brilliant Ways People Celebrate Karwa Chauth across the country.
In this blog, we will talk about the Karva Chauth pooja and its importance. But before that, let us find out how married women observe Karwa Chauth fast? The women keep this fast without having a single drop of water. Indian brides wear a traditional outfit and apply mehendi on their hands to perform the Karwa Chauth Vrat. In Hindu mythology, women can break the fast only after sighting the moon in the sky. Following the prayers, the couple exchanges the sweets to themselves and ends the fast.
The festival of Karwa Chauth is celebrated across the nation, mainly in Northern states like Punjab, Haryana, Delhi, and Uttar Pradesh. During this festival, women also worship Lord Shiva and Lord Parvati to seek longevity of their partner.
Karva Chauth 2020 - Pooja, Date and time
This year Karva Chauth will be observed on the 4th of November, Wednesday. Below are the date and timings to be noted:
Karwa Chauth Tithi Timings:
Chaturthi Starts: November 4th, 2020 at 03:24 AM
Chaturthi Ends: November 5th, 2020 at 05:14 AM
Karwa Chauth Puja Muhurat: 05:32 PM to 06:52 PM
Timings for Karwa Chauth Vrat: 06:35 AM to 08:12 PM
Moonrise: 08:12 PM
During the Karwa Chauth pooja, breaking the fast and exchange of gifts can be done, once the beautiful sight of the Moon is visible. The married woman dresses like a bride in auspicious colours of Karva Chauth and stands along with her husband in front of the glowing moon. Later, the couple performs the rituals by singing folk songs, where the husband helps his better half to end the fast.
How to perform Karva Chauth Pooja?
There are some Do’s and Don’ts for Karva Chauth that one needs to keep in mind. Here is how to perform Karva Chauth Puja accurately:
Following sunrise, set yourself free from the day-to-day work.
Chant Hindu mantras while taking a bath in order to start your Karwa Chauth fast.
Then you can begin your one-day Fast. You should not consume food or drink water until you see the Moon.
In the evening, perform Ganesh pooja and worship the Goddess Parvati and the God Shiva. In case you are not aware of the Vedic rituals let our experts in performing Ganesh Puja online at the comforts of your home.
Look out for the glimpse of the Moon and once the Moon is visible, break the day-long fast.
Break your fast by drinking water and eating sweets from your husband’s hand.
Seek blessings from God and elderly people of your family.
Myth of Karva Chauth Vrat
According to the Hindu belief, the story of queen Veervati gave us the reason to observe Karva Chauth Vrat. The queen Veervati was the first one to keep the Karwa Chauth Vrat. The queen waited for the moon to appear so that she could break the fast. Later, the queen found herself unwell and seeing this, her brothers requested her to break the fast. When the queen refused to do so, her brothers came up with a bait and Veervati fell into it. When the queen agreed to break the fast, the news arrived that her husband, the King, was dead.
In Mahabharata, Draupadi kept the Karwa Chauth Vrat for the Pandavas. Similarly, goddess Parvati also had Karwa Chauth Vrat for her husband, Lord Shiva. Another tale behind the famous Karva Chauth Vrat is of women Karva who challenged Yama (God of death), and in return, she earned the longevity of her husband.
Wrapping Up:
Now, you know how this fast is being observed on Karwa Chauth and the significance of performing it. Women since ages keep Vrat to seek blessings for the longevity of their husbands. This not only shows the love of women to their husbands but also to her in-laws. In fact, the unmarried girls also keep Vrat on this day to fulfil their desire of getting a caring life partner.

Ahoi Ashtami 2020: Ahoi Ashtami Vrat Date, Significance & Rituals
Tumblr media
About Ahoi Ashtami puja: Significance, Rituals, and Tradition
Ahoi Ashtami festival is a well-known festival celebrated all across Northern India before the start of Deepawali and after “Karwa Chauth”. The day is also known as “Ahoi Aathe”. Traditionally, on this day women observed the fast till twilight for the well-being of her children. After darkness, they break the fast by sighting the stars. Some women even break the fast by sighting the Moon but it might be difficult to follow the fast as the Moon rises very late in the night.
Basically, Ahoi Ashtami is a festival for the son, in which all the mothers observe the fast from the day to dusk for the well-being of her son. On this day, all the mothers worship the deity Ahoi with utmost fervour and pray for their child’s well being.
Ahoi Mata Varat story:
The story of this festival starts with the women who had 7 sons. Once when the only few days were left for Diwali the family was engaged in cleaning the house. This Diwali you can invite prosperity, luck, and blessings of Goddess Lakshmi with Meru Prushth Shree Yantra. while renovating the house, she went to collect mud from an open pit near the River. While digging the soil, she unknowingly killed the offspring of the hedgehog (sei), who later cursed her. Thereafter, the curse proved fatal for their son and one by one she lost all the seven sons. She realised that this is because of that curse, and to shed this curse, she observed six-day long fast and prayed to Ahoi Mata. Seeing her devotion, Mata Ahoi pleased and gave her all the seven sons back.
Ahoi Mata Varat Vidhi:
This festival is akin to the festival Karva Chauth, the only difference is that Karva Chauth is for Husband’s well-being and Ahoi festival is for the well being of the son. On this day, all the women or mothers wake up early in the morning and take a bath. Later, she takes a pledge or “Sankalp” that she will observe and complete the fast, and then they perform the vrat without food and water until the sighting of the Star or Moon in the dark sky.
Rituals of Ahoi Ashtami Vrat:
Ahoi Ashtami vrat is supposed to be done before the sunset.
Firstly, the image of the idol is drawn on the wall. If you can not make the image,  then the wallpaper of deity can also be used. The image of the Ahoi Ashtami should consist of eight corners owing to its association with Ashtami-Tithi. A picture of hedgehog (Sei) or Cub is also drawn close to the goddess Ahoi.  
A holy Kalash filled with water is placed at the left side of the Ahoi Ashtami idol on the wooden platform. Then a swastika on the Kalash is drawn, and a sacred thread is tied around the Kalash.
Then the eldest member of the family recites the Vrat Katha to all the women of the family. Each woman is required to hold 7 ounces of grain in their hand while listening to Katha.
In some communities, Ahoi Mata of silver known as syau is made and worshipped. After the puja, it can be worn as a pendant around the neck by all the women.
Thereafter, Rice and Milk is offered to the deity along with Vayana and cooked food which includes poori, Halwa, and Pua.
At the end “Ahoi Mata aarti” is performed to mark the termination of the puja.
